Write the first five terms of the sequences whose nth term is:
`a_n = n (n^2 + 5)/4`

उत्तर
an = `"n"("n"^2 + 5)/4`
Substituting n = 1, 2, 3, 4, 5, we get
a1 = `1 (1^2 + 5)/4 = 6/4 = 3/2`,
a2 = `2 (2^2 + 5)/4 = (2 xx 9)/4 = 9/2`,
a3 = `3 (3^2 + 5)/4 = (3 xx 14)/4 = 21/2`,
a4 = `4 (4^2 + 5)/4 = (4 xx 21)/4` = 21,
a5 = `5 (5^2 + 5)/4 = (5 xx 30)/4 = 75/2`
Hence, the five terms of the sequence are `3/2, 9/2, 21/2, 21, 75/2`.
